It's been a year since we got to watch the Metal Gear Solid Snake Eater 3D demo at E3 2010, and it's been all quiet from there. Today, news finally broke at Konami's pre-E3 press conference. While the full Metal Gear Solid 3: Snake Eater game is included and still putting you in the boots of Naked Snake, the 2011 version is making use of its brand new platform's bells and whistles.

"Photo-Camo" will allow players to take a photo with the 3DS camera and use that image as in-game camouflage for Snake's outfit. No word on how this'll affect gameplay as the original game was big on matching the right camo with the right situation.

Another addition are parts of the game making use of the 3DS' gyro-sensor (the doodad in the handheld that can tell if it's being titled). When Snake comes to a narrow bridge or tree he needs to shimmy across, players will need to tilt their 3DS' to mimic Snake's balance. Otherwise, he'll fall to an untimely death.


The end of the Metal Gear Solid Snake Eater 3D trailer also showed Snake stumble upon a Yoshi figurine. Is this a one of the Metal Gear Solid franchise's famous gags or a hint of a tie-in similar to Metal Gear Solid 3: Subsistence's Ape Escape content? We'll have to wait and see.
